How did you two meet?

Tim says:  We actually met one night at a University of Maryland intramural softball game, but she doesn’t remember.  I, on the other hand, could not stop thinking about her.  We got to know each other by playing on a different softball team together, which is where she thought we met.

University of Maryland College Park engagement photos Baltimore Maryland wedding photographer Sarah Harper PhotographyUniversity of Maryland College Park engagement photos Baltimore Maryland wedding photographer Sarah Harper PhotographyUniversity of Maryland College Park engagement photos Baltimore Maryland wedding photographer Sarah Harper PhotographyUniversity of Maryland College Park engagement photos Baltimore Maryland wedding photographer Sarah Harper Photography

Describe your first date:

Tim says:  Our first date was at the original Ledo’s Pizza. While it was not an official date, it was a lot of fun and we were able to find out more about one another.

Lindsay says:  I remember I got an orange crush and we sat at the bar eating pizza and hanging out. We had been spending the past couple of weeks together out with mutual friends from UMD, but that was our first official date.

University of Maryland College Park engagement photos Baltimore Maryland wedding photographer Sarah Harper PhotographyUniversity of Maryland College Park engagement photos Baltimore Maryland wedding photographer Sarah Harper PhotographyUniversity of Maryland College Park engagement photos Baltimore Maryland wedding photographer Sarah Harper PhotographyUniversity of Maryland College Park engagement photos Baltimore Maryland wedding photographer Sarah Harper Photography

Proposal story:

Tim says:  I proposed on my birthday and wanted to get the best birthday gift ever. Lindsay had planned a surprise birthday party for me at 8407 Kitchen Bar in Silver Spring, but I actually knew about it. I invited more friends and family than she originally had planned and proposed to her after dinner in front of everyone.

Lindsay says:
When we walked into 8407, there were flowers, a large poster of pictures of us, and way more of our friends and family then I had invited to the birthday party. He told me that from the first time he saw me he never stopped thinking about me and then got down on one knee and asked me to make it the best birthday ever and marry him!  I said, “Of course!” and was in complete shock that he had just proposed to me in public. We got to share the rest of the night with friends and family, which was something that I really appreciated in the end!
